The report examines Spain’s compliance with its international human rights obligations, covering: gender based violence, treatment of ethnic and religious minorities, treatment of  immigrants, unlawful detention, and law enforcement abuse.
Focus of the Spain UPR 2014 Report:

Violence Against Women / Reproductive Rights

Situation of Ethnic Minorities

Situation of Migrants -Work, Law Enforcement Interaction

Religious Freedom
